Output 73bf242e1a2b5ecf1e99bcd33e005156d034b6ce85f0c2c07c0b938c57ab3145:0

value
102153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199a415c5f9b92ea5b83242cb7fa31b5abf45845 OP_EQUAL
address
342PcBnUkBA5ZdEN8qhn7APL9hvXpq3Ue9
transaction
73bf242e1a2b5ecf1e99bcd33e005156d034b6ce85f0c2c07c0b938c57ab3145
confirmations
384730
spent
true